Fighting coal power with commercials. A new effort seeks to bring some Reality to the idea of clean coal. Host Mike Tidwell speaks to Rob Perks, the director for advocacy programs at the Natural Resources Defense Council about both the Reality campaign and the Clean Coal Carolers – that’s right, singing lumps of coal harmonizing about the benefits of the dirtiest form of energy.

Francesca Grifo is the director of the Scientific Integrity Program of the Union of Concerned Scientists – a program that didn’t even have to exist before the Bush Administration. Grifo joins us to discuss the program’s “Top 10 New Year’s Resolutions’ for the upcoming Obama Administration.

Education and action are the goals of the National Teach-In on Global Warming. The Teach-In is directed by Eban Goodstein, who’s also an economics professor at the Lewis and Clark College in Oregon. And Earthbeat host Mike Tidwell discusses the benefits of a carbon cap and dividend plan.
